// Consent banner rollout for the Quillmark web app.
// Heads up: we're ramping the new banner by cohort, not by region,
// so don't assume geo gating — that was the old Pinegate scheme.
// Dismissal state is stored client-side only until consent is logged.
// Ramp percentages and retry backoffs live in the constants below.

constants for tageg-kagag:
QUOTAS = {
    "kelax": 495,
    "istath": 366,
    "tammir": 108,
    "novdor": 730,
    "casax": 816,
    "quenael": 874,
    "pelius": 403,
}

Ticket: Expired credentials blocking cutoff enforcement — Crumbline plugin API.

The Crumbline order-cutoff rule (no custom cake orders after 14:00 for next-day pickup) stopped firing Tuesday. Root cause: the cutoff-validator service account credential expired, so plugin calls silently fell back to accept-all. Plugin authors must swap in the rotated credential and redeploy before Friday. The replacement key for the cutoff service follows below.

service key, yadug-bajog: zpat3_pou

Support team: these constants govern the migration shim between the legacy Copperline broker and the new Drayvault 4 cluster. During the cutover window, producers dual-write and the shim reconciles by message fingerprint, so duplicate deliveries are expected and deduped downstream. If customers report delayed messages, check the reconcile lag metric before escalating — anything under the lag ceiling here is normal. Do not change these values in a hotfix; they were load-tested together as a set. Current tuning values are as follows.

tuning constants:
QUOTAS = {
    "druwyn": 5,
    "holix": 5,
    "zorath": 5,
    "holwyn": 10,
}